Bill
Summary: AB 1114 would define the "forms and notices" that are
required to be translated into threshold languages as part of
the application and enrollment process for Medi-Cal and coverage
through Covered California.
Fiscal
Impact:
Unknown costs to make programmatic changes to information
technology systems (General Fund, federal funds, special
fund). Through the CalHEERs system, eligibility determinations
and notifications for Medi-Cal and Covered California are
largely automated. Currently, CalHEERs has only been
programmed to issue redetermination forms or notices of action
in English or Spanish (depending on the applicant's stated
language preference). In order to issue redetermination forms,
notices of action, and other documents in the

applicant/enrollee's language of preference, the CalHEERs
system will need programming changes.
Committee
Amendments: Narrow the definition of "forms and notices" to
only include application and renewal forms and notices of
action.
